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
981272967 7281490 26791268 57
4268352528 17
4268352528 17
60351 135065 181794
All about undefined
Interested in learning more?
4268352528 17
60351 135065 181794
See more
915024491 0845260929
02268 005 567342607 16468
See more
599191024 667723175 30429749
60188 57875159561 21672192 508
See more